diff options
author | Ingo Molnar <mingo@elte.hu> | 2008-11-03 02:57:41 -0500 |
---|---|---|
committer | Ingo Molnar <mingo@elte.hu> | 2008-11-03 02:57:41 -0500 |
commit | db5935001a43528e673ad26ffec9d98c60a496a9 (patch) | |
tree | 8e735327a97beccabb5d94ef93df25d2bacda705 /drivers/net/wireless/p54/p54common.c | |
parent | 34f3a814eef8069a24e5b3ebcf27aba9dabac2ea (diff) | |
parent | 45beca08dd8b6d6a65c5ffd730af2eac7a2c7a03 (diff) |
Merge commit 'v2.6.28-rc3' into sched/core
Diffstat (limited to 'drivers/net/wireless/p54/p54common.c')
-rw-r--r-- | drivers/net/wireless/p54/p54common.c | 5 |
1 files changed, 3 insertions, 2 deletions
diff --git a/drivers/net/wireless/p54/p54common.c b/drivers/net/wireless/p54/p54common.c index 2d022f83774c..827ca0384a4c 100644 --- a/drivers/net/wireless/p54/p54common.c +++ b/drivers/net/wireless/p54/p54common.c | |||
@@ -319,7 +319,7 @@ static int p54_parse_eeprom(struct ieee80211_hw *dev, void *eeprom, int len) | |||
319 | void *tmp; | 319 | void *tmp; |
320 | int err; | 320 | int err; |
321 | u8 *end = (u8 *)eeprom + len; | 321 | u8 *end = (u8 *)eeprom + len; |
322 | u16 synth; | 322 | u16 synth = 0; |
323 | DECLARE_MAC_BUF(mac); | 323 | DECLARE_MAC_BUF(mac); |
324 | 324 | ||
325 | wrap = (struct eeprom_pda_wrap *) eeprom; | 325 | wrap = (struct eeprom_pda_wrap *) eeprom; |
@@ -422,7 +422,8 @@ static int p54_parse_eeprom(struct ieee80211_hw *dev, void *eeprom, int len) | |||
422 | entry = (void *)entry + (entry_len + 1)*2; | 422 | entry = (void *)entry + (entry_len + 1)*2; |
423 | } | 423 | } |
424 | 424 | ||
425 | if (!priv->iq_autocal || !priv->output_limit || !priv->curve_data) { | 425 | if (!synth || !priv->iq_autocal || !priv->output_limit || |
426 | !priv->curve_data) { | ||
426 | printk(KERN_ERR "p54: not all required entries found in eeprom!\n"); | 427 | printk(KERN_ERR "p54: not all required entries found in eeprom!\n"); |
427 | err = -EINVAL; | 428 | err = -EINVAL; |
428 | goto err; | 429 | goto err; |